'21 JT with 95,000 miles, have had this rattle on cold start since probably 20,000 miles. I have had it in 3 times to the dealer and every time they say they can't hear it. To me, it's deafening.
I am 90% sure it's a cam phaser. Lasts anywhere from 5-10 seconds after cold start, on bad days it will rattle but then make a "surging" noise for up to 30 seconds.
I've run oil analyses before with nothing terribly concerning, so I don't think it's camshaft.
I am coming up on the end of my Chrysler Maxcare warranty here, and I just know the dealer is kicking this down the road to make it my $5000 problem when it's 100 yards out of warranty.
Do I have any recourse here? Or maybe this is just what this garbage engine sounds like?
